Christ, character of » Resisting temptation
Then Jesus was led up into the wilderness by the Spirit, to be tempted by the devil. And having fasted forty days and forty nights, He afterward hungered. And the tempter having come to Him, said; If thou art the Son of God, speak in order that these stones may become bread. read more.
And He responding said; It has been written, A man shall not live upon bread alone, but upon every word coming forth through the mouth of God. Then the devil takes Him into the holy city and stood Him on the pinnacle of the temple, and says to Him; If thou art the Son of God, cast thyself down; for it has been written, That He will give His angels charge concerning thee, and upon their hand they will bear thee, lest thou mayest dash thy foot against a stone. Jesus said to him; Again it has been written, Thou shalt not tempt the Lord thy God. Again the devil takes Him into an exceedingly high mountain, and shows Him all the kingdoms of the world and the glory of the same, and said to Him; All these things will I give unto thee, If having fallen down thou mayest worship me: then Jesus says to him, Get behind me, Satan; for it has been written; Thou shalt worship the Lord thy God, and Him only shalt thou serve.

And Jesus, full of the Holy Ghost, returned from the Jordan and was led by the Spirit into the wilderness, tempted by the devil forty days. And He ate nothing during those days; and they having been completed, He afterward hungered. And the devil said to Him, If thou art the Son of God, speak to this stone, in order that it may become bread. read more.
And Jesus responded to him, saying; It has been written, That man shall not live upon bread alone, but upon every word of God. And the devil leading Him up, he showed Him all the kingdoms of the world in a moment of time. And the devil said to Him, I will give all the authority and glories of these to thee: because it has been given unto me: and I give it to whom I may wish; then if thou mayest worship before me all shall belong to thee. And Jesus responding said to him; It has been written, Thou shalt worship the Lord thy God and Him only shalt thou serve. And he led Him into Jerusalem, and placed Him on a pinnacle of the temple, and said to Him, If thou art the Son of God cast thyself down from thence; for it has been written, That He will give His angels charge concerning thee, in order to guard thee, and they will bear thee upon their hands, lest at any time thou mayest dash thy foot against a stone. And Jesus responding said to him; That it has been said, Thou shalt not tempt the Lord thy God. And the devil having perfected every temptation, departed from Him for a season.
